Coupecabriolet Clutched July 13, 2012 Share July 13, 2012 Give you a bit more choices before you part with your hard-earned money : 1. VW Beetle - The new version is more manly looking, and its also an iconic car. Better boot and back seats space than Mini. Priced less than Mini Cooper, although more than Koup. 2. Citroen DS3 - Similar mold to Mini, although not iconic. 3. Opel Astra GTC - Sporting looks, also better boot and back seat space than Mini. No harm in test driving them all before deciding. Good choices, although the New New Beetle is going to cost abit more than the Mini. And if i'm not wrong, the entry level is the 1.2TSI or 1.4TSI, not the faster twincharged version. Citroen DS3 is rare on our roads, but still a looker. Ford Fiesta (3 door version) and Opel Astra GTC are also good options. Not forgetting the more common ones like Scirocco and Golf.
